Lemony Summer Squash Recipe


Recipe Ingredients:

1 lb Summer squash
1 tbsp Walnut oil
1 cl Garlic, minced
1 tsp Dried rosemary, crumbled
2 tbsp Fresh lemon juice

 

Recipe Instructions:

Slice squash in 1/4" rounds. Heat oil in a non-stick skillet and cook
garlic 1 minute. Add squash and cook, stirring gently, until tender,
about 4 minutes. Stir in remaining ingredients and heat through.

Food Exchange per serving: 1 VEGETABLES EXCHANGE; CAL: 31; CHO: 0mg;
PRO: 1mg; SOD: 3mg; FAT: 2g;

Source: Light & Easy Diabetic Cuisine by Betty Marks
Brought you and yours via Nancy O'Brion and her Meal-Master

Servings: 4
